The Saxapahaw Rivermill Farmers' Market, Music Series and Kid's 
Activities take place every Saturday from 5-8pm through August 26th.   
All events are in downtown Saxapahaw outside next to the Post Office 
and across from the Saxapahaw Rivermill. It's a beautiful day out and 
all are welcome.  A complete summer schedule, lists of bands, farmers, 
directions, pictures, maps and events can be found at 
www.rivermillvillage.com/farmers.html
